#100ab5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#100ab5 is composed of 6.3% red, 3.9%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 94.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 37.5%. #100ab5 color hex could be obtained by blending #2014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#100ab5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#100ab5 has RGB values of R:16, G:10,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1051317.

Shades and Tints of #100ab5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010e is the darkest color, while #fafa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#100ab5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5b64 is the less saturated color, while #0903bc is the most saturated one.
